About this audiobook
This book is a chair pulled close to the kitchen table. A warm cup between your hands. A little lamp glowing in the corner when the rest of the house has gone quiet. It is the kind of conversation you have when you are finally honest enough to say, “I am tired,” and kind enough to yourself not to apologize for it.
Because sometimes, tired does not mean lazy.
Sometimes, tired means you have been strong for too long.
Sometimes, tired means your mind has been carrying conversations, fears, memories, responsibilities, disappointments, and silent prayers that no one else even knows about.
Sometimes, tired means you have been getting through days that looked ordinary on the outside but felt heavy on the inside.
And still, here you are.
